Abstract

This paper describes a new method to enhance data handling and reduce effort in power system analysis. The power system is very large and incorporates many pieces of equipment. To reduce effort in power system analysis, it is necessary to increase data handling efficiency. However, conventional power system analysis applications incur a complicated data format requiring experienced operators and/or planners. On the other hand, many useful data-handling methods are provided by information technology (IT). In this paper, a graphical user interface and database function are applied to data handling and are installed in an integrated power system analysis package, named IMPACT.
